Under the big top

The Obie Award-winning Big Apple Circus returns to Hanover for its annual summer run. With a live band, world-class clowning, split-second juggling trapeze acts and astounding slack-wire acrobats, the Big Apple brings the artistry, intimacy and creativity of classical circus to kids and grownups alike. The creation of 1964 Dartmouth graduate Paul Binder and celebrating its 30th anniversary this year, the Big Apple Circus opens Saturday and runs through July 24.
